About This Coffee

Evergreen is a characterful coffee sourced from Jalapa in Nueva Segovia, Nicaragua, blended from lots grown by smallholders (including Cleofe Cruz and Efrain Roque). Cleofe’s Caturra at 1,637 m and Efrain’s Catuaí at 1,350 m undergo a 36–48 hour fermentation before being fully washed, producing rich, chocolatey depth with layered sweetness and tasting notes of plum, fudge and chocolate biscuit.

Workshop Coffee

Workshop Coffee is a well-established sourcing, roasting and brewing company based in London, England, founded in 2011 by James Dickson and recognised as one of the UK’s leading specialty coffee brands with a strong reputation for quality and craft. Roasting takes place at its production facility in London with meticulous quality control, including repeated cupping and precision roasting processes designed to highlight each coffee’s inherent characteristics. They offer a range of single-origin coffees, curated house blends, espresso and filter selections, and seasonally rotated roasts that reflect harvest cycles.
